  • A Black Man’s Coming of Age in the Age of Obama

    In the title of his first book, Invisible Man, Got the Whole World Watching: A Young Black Man’s Education, The Nation contributing writer Mychal Denzel Smith calls to mind three works: Ralph Ellison’s classic Invisible Man, Mos Def’s “Hip-Hop” and Lauryn Hill’s seminal album The Miseducation of Lauryn Hill.
